Abstract

Non-destructive testing of carbide phase anisotropy in the material (steel EI961) of the rotor blades of a high-pressure turbine compressor (HPTC) by optical metallography and ultrasonic pulse-echo techniques directly after operation and after tempering has been carried out. A correlation between the parameter of intrinsic acoustic anisotropy and the coefficient of structural anisotropy of the carbide phase was established
